Having just clocked up 55 episodes of Shiny New Object, Tom Ollerton is a prolific podcaster - an achievement that’s all the more impressive given that Tom founded AI start-up Automated Creative just last year.

The Shiny New Object podcast sees Tom interview marketing innovation magpies about the latest emerging technologies. Previous guests include Gerry D’Angelo, Global Media Director, P&G, Jeremy Waite, Chief Strategy Officer, IBM Watson and Tristan Thomas, Head of Marketing, Monzo.

This episode sees Tom speak to Fátima Diez International Brand Manager at Five Guys about how she makes people want burgers without spending any money on marketing, paid media or vouchering.

Diez, who recently featured in The Drum’s 50 under 30 list, explains to how Five Guys listens to its customers in-store and on social media to “grow genuine love instead of paying people to love us.”

Diez is also wary of buzzwords and calls for brands to think carefully about what’s right for their brand, rather than jump on the latest bandwagon.
